I just replaced the spark plugs on my 2014 Cadillac ELR(essentially a gen 1 volt). My ELR has 81000 miles on it. It still had the factory plugs. One of the plugs was leaking compression as seen in the photo. If you have a first gen volt or an ELR, if the plugs have never been changed, it won't hurt to take a look at them. I replaced them with NGK 94279 spark plugs.
